What is the salary for English Speaking Design Jobs in Luxembourg?
The salary for English speaking design jobs in Luxembourg can vary depending on several factors such as the city, level of experience, and specific design field. In general, salaries for entry-level design jobs range from €35,000 to €45,000 per year, while more experienced professionals can earn up to €90,000 or more per year.
In addition to the above factors, salaries can also vary depending on the specific design field. For example, salaries for UX designers and digital designers tend to be higher than for traditional graphic designers.
It's also worth noting that salaries can vary significantly depending on the company and industry. For example, designers working in advertising, marketing, or technology companies may earn higher salaries than those working in smaller design studios or agencies.

What type of visa sponsorship do you need for English Speaking Design Jobs in Luxembourg as an Expat
As an expat looking for English speaking design jobs in Luxembourg, you will need a work permit and a residence permit. Luxembourg has specific regulations for non-EU citizens who wish to work in the country, and the employer will usually need to apply for a work permit on your behalf.
The work permit is usually valid for one year and can be renewed as long as you continue to meet the requirements. To obtain a work permit, you will need to provide a valid passport, a job offer from a Luxembourg employer, and proof that you meet the qualifications and experience required for the position.
In addition to the work permit, you will also need a residence permit to legally reside in Luxembourg while working. The residence permit application will usually be submitted along with the work permit application, and you will need to provide proof of accommodation and health insurance coverage.
It is important to note that the process for obtaining a work and residence permit can be lengthy and may require additional documentation, so it is advisable to start the process as early as possible.

What are the different interview questions asked for English Design Jobs in Luxembourg
If you're applying for English design jobs in Luxembourg, it's important to be prepared for the interview process. Here are some common interview questions you may encounter:
Can you walk me through your design process, from ideation to execution?
What design software and tools are you most proficient in, and how have you used them in your previous work?
Can you show me examples of your previous design work and explain the thought process behind each project?
How do you stay up-to-date with design trends and advancements in your field?
Can you describe a time when you had to collaborate with a team on a design project, and how you contributed to the team's success?
How do you incorporate user feedback into your designs, and what steps do you take to ensure a positive user experience?
Can you describe a project where you had to balance aesthetics and functionality, and how you approached that challenge?
How do you handle feedback and critique on your designs, and how do you use that feedback to improve your work?
What design challenges have you faced in the past, and how did you overcome them?
Can you discuss a project where you had to work with a tight deadline or budget, and how you managed to deliver a quality design outcome?
By being prepared for these types of interview questions, you can showcase your design skills and experience and increase your chances of landing your desired job in Luxembourg.
